Solid Plate-based Dietary Restriction in Caenorhabditis elegans

Dietary restriction extends lifespan in the nematode Caenorhabditis elegans by influencing autophagy, energy sensing, and hypoxic responses. Key tissues like the intestine and neurons are vital for this life extension.
